Mastering the Tapping and Pressure Movements
The secret lies in rhythmic patterns. I start with light taps resembling keyboard typing – quick, consistent motions across temples and forehead. This activates circulation without irritating delicate tissues.
Three-second holds make all the difference. At each strategic spot near my brows and nose bridge, I press gently before releasing. This pulse-like action helps nutrients reach surface cells while flushing toxins.
Step-by-Step Ritual I Follow Daily
My ritual begins with clean hands and a pea-sized amount of serum. Starting at the inner corner, I trace three full circles using my ring finger. The motion flows outward along brows, under orbital bones, then up the nose bridge.
Specific points receive extra attention. Point four gets upward pressure, point five directs toward my nose. This sequence ends with temple circles using index and middle fingers – releasing stored tension.
Using My Ring Finger for Precise Pressure
This digit became my ultimate tool. Its natural weakness prevents over-pressing, making it perfect for sensitive zones. When gliding across bone structure, I maintain contact without dragging.
The technique feels like sketching contours. Three clockwise rotations at outer corners complete the process. What began as careful practice now flows effortlessly – proof that consistency breeds mastery.
